Transaction e32b11d8c3dac3194fed096c24c60583216d83f106e76fa4d0e2ce650f84d772
1 Input
1 Output
-
e32b11d8c3dac3194fed096c24c60583216d83f106e76fa4d0e2ce650f84d772:0
- value
- 505888
- script pubkey
- OP_0 OP_PUSHBYTES_20 40ff0753c3bff42196c3f7685521b397c182454e
- address
- bc1qgrlsw57rhl6zr9kr7a592gdnjlqcy32wwzy8mf